The Appeal of Auctions: Opportunities and Advantages

Real estate auctions offer multiple benefits. For sellers, they provide a rapid sale method, minimizing holding costs. For buyers, they offer the chance to purchase properties at potentially below-market prices. Additionally, the transparent bidding process ensures fair competition.

The Flip Side: Challenges and Considerations

Despite their potential, real estate auctions also pose significant risks. Properties are typically sold “as is,” giving buyers limited recourse if issues arise post-purchase. Additionally, competition can drive prices up, potentially eroding profit margins. These challenges underscore the importance of thorough research and due diligence.
